Deciphering the Diversities of Astroviruses and Noroviruses in Wastewater Treatment Plant Effluents by a High-Throughput Sequencing Method.
Applied and environmental microbiology - 1 Oct 2015
Prevost B, Lucas F S, Ambert-Balay K, Pothier P, Moulin L, Wurtzer S
Abstract excerpt
Although clinical epidemiology lists human enteric viruses to be among the primary causes of acute gastroenteritis in the human population, their circulation in the environment remains poorly investigated. These viruses are excreted by the human population into sewers and may be released into rivers through the effluents of wastewater treatment plants (WWTPs).
